And a bike with unparalleled fit and finish. In short, a bike that only Honda can deliver. The Interceptor's 782 cc V-4 VTEC engine has new fuel-injection mapping for better low-end torque feel. It includes adjustable seat height to better fit a range of riders, new front-mount radiator for a slimmer profile, radial-mount front brakes, and all-new side-muffler, wheels and Pro-Arm swingarm. There’s even a Deluxe model for 2014 with features like traction control, Anti-Lock Brakes, self-cancelling turn signals, a centerstand and heated grips. MotoGP‘s Grand Prix Commission announced the series will adopt a standardized Engine Control Unit hardware and software programming for all entries starting with the 2016 season. At the moment, all teams are required to use a standard ECU hardware supplied by Magneti Marelli. Teams competing under the Factory option are allowed to use their own proprietary software programming while Open option participants must use standardized software.
The International Motorcycling Federation (FIM) has released a preliminary entry list for the 2012 MotoGP World Championship. The provisional list includes 21 riders in the premiere class, including nine classified as Claiming Rule Team entries. Defending MotoGP Champion Casey Stoner will wear the #1 plate for the 2012 season, the first with both CRT entries and the new 1000cc engine displacement cap.
